  1. /*
  2. * Asterisk -- An open source telephony toolkit.
  3. *
  4. * Copyright (C) 1999 - 2005, Digium, Inc.
  5. *
  6. * Mark Spencer <markster@digium.com>
  7. *
  8. * See http://www.asterisk.org for more information about
  9. * the Asterisk project. Please do not directly contact
  10. * any of the maintainers of this project for assistance;
  11. * the project provides a web site, mailing lists and IRC
  12. * channels for your use.
  13. *
  14. * This program is free software, distributed under the terms of
  15. * the GNU General Public License Version 2. See the LICENSE file
  16. * at the top of the source tree.
  17. */
  18. /*! \file
  19. *
  20. * \brief Network broadcast sound support channel driver
  21. *
  22. * \author Mark Spencer <markster@digium.com>
  23. *
  24. * \ingroup channel_drivers
  25. */
  26. #include <stdio.h>
  27. #include <string.h>
  28. #include <sys/socket.h>
  29. #include <sys/time.h>
  30. #include <errno.h>
  31. #include <unistd.h>
  32. #include <stdlib.h>
  33. #include <arpa/inet.h>
  34. #include <fcntl.h>
  35. #include <sys/ioctl.h>
  36. #include <nbs.h>
  37. #include "asterisk.h"
  38. ASTERISK_FILE_VERSION(__FILE__, "$Revision$")
  39. #include "asterisk/lock.h"
  40. #include "asterisk/channel.h"
  41. #include "asterisk/config.h"
  42. #include "asterisk/logger.h"
  43. #include "asterisk/module.h"
  44. #include "asterisk/pbx.h"
  45. #include "asterisk/options.h"
  46. #include "asterisk/utils.h"
  47. static const char desc[] = "Network Broadcast Sound Support";
  48. static const char type[] = "NBS";
  49. static const char tdesc[] = "Network Broadcast Sound Driver";
  50. static int usecnt =0;
  51. /* Only linear is allowed */
  52. static int prefformat = AST_FORMAT_SLINEAR;
  53. AST_MUTEX_DEFINE_STATIC(usecnt_lock);
  54. static char context[AST_MAX_EXTENSION] = "default";
  55. /* NBS creates private structures on demand */
  56. struct nbs_pvt {
  57. NBS *nbs;
  58. struct ast_channel *owner; /* Channel we belong to, possibly NULL */
  59. char app[16]; /* Our app */
  60. char stream[80]; /* Our stream */
  61. struct ast_frame fr; /* "null" frame */
  62. };
  63. static struct ast_channel *nbs_request(const char *type, int format, void *data, int *cause);
  64. static int nbs_call(struct ast_channel *ast, char *dest, int timeout);
  65. static int nbs_hangup(struct ast_channel *ast);
  66. static struct ast_frame *nbs_xread(struct ast_channel *ast);
  67. static int nbs_xwrite(struct ast_channel *ast, struct ast_frame *frame);
  68. static const struct ast_channel_tech nbs_tech = {
  69. .type = type,
  70. .description = tdesc,
  71. .capabilities = AST_FORMAT_SLINEAR,
  72. .requester = nbs_request,
  73. .call = nbs_call,
  74. .hangup = nbs_hangup,
  75. .read = nbs_xread,
  76. .write = nbs_xwrite,
  77. };
  78. static int nbs_call(struct ast_channel *ast, char *dest, int timeout)
  79. {
  80. struct nbs_pvt *p;
  81. p = ast->tech_pvt;
  82. if ((ast->_state != AST_STATE_DOWN) && (ast->_state != AST_STATE_RESERVED)) {
  83. ast_log(LOG_WARNING, "nbs_call called on %s, neither down nor reserved\n", ast->name);
  84. return -1;
  85. }
  86. /* When we call, it just works, really, there's no destination... Just
  87. ring the phone and wait for someone to answer */
  88. if (option_debug)
  89. ast_log(LOG_DEBUG, "Calling %s on %s\n", dest, ast->name);
  90. /* If we can't connect, return congestion */
  91. if (nbs_connect(p->nbs)) {
  92. ast_log(LOG_WARNING, "NBS Connection failed on %s\n", ast->name);
  93. ast_queue_control(ast, AST_CONTROL_CONGESTION);
  94. } else {
  95. ast_setstate(ast, AST_STATE_RINGING);
  96. ast_queue_control(ast, AST_CONTROL_ANSWER);
  97. }
  98. return 0;
  99. }
  100. static void nbs_destroy(struct nbs_pvt *p)
  101. {
  102. if (p->nbs)
  103. nbs_delstream(p->nbs);
  104. free(p);
  105. }
  106. static struct nbs_pvt *nbs_alloc(void *data)
  107. {
  108. struct nbs_pvt *p;
  109. int flags = 0;
  110. char stream[256] = "";
  111. char *opts;
  112. strncpy(stream, data, sizeof(stream) - 1);
  113. if ((opts = strchr(stream, ':'))) {
  114. *opts = '\0';
  115. opts++;
  116. } else
  117. opts = "";
  118. p = malloc(sizeof(struct nbs_pvt));
  119. if (p) {
  120. memset(p, 0, sizeof(struct nbs_pvt));
  121. if (!ast_strlen_zero(opts)) {
  122. if (strchr(opts, 'm'))
  123. flags |= NBS_FLAG_MUTE;
  124. if (strchr(opts, 'o'))
  125. flags |= NBS_FLAG_OVERSPEAK;
  126. if (strchr(opts, 'e'))
  127. flags |= NBS_FLAG_EMERGENCY;
  128. if (strchr(opts, 'O'))
  129. flags |= NBS_FLAG_OVERRIDE;
  130. } else
  131. flags = NBS_FLAG_OVERSPEAK;
  132. strncpy(p->stream, stream, sizeof(p->stream) - 1);
  133. p->nbs = nbs_newstream("asterisk", stream, flags);
  134. if (!p->nbs) {
  135. ast_log(LOG_WARNING, "Unable to allocate new NBS stream '%s' with flags %d\n", stream, flags);
  136. free(p);
  137. p = NULL;
  138. } else {
  139. /* Set for 8000 hz mono, 640 samples */
  140. nbs_setbitrate(p->nbs, 8000);
  141. nbs_setchannels(p->nbs, 1);
  142. nbs_setblocksize(p->nbs, 640);
  143. nbs_setblocking(p->nbs, 0);
  144. }
  145. }
  146. return p;
  147. }
  148. static int nbs_hangup(struct ast_channel *ast)
  149. {
  150. struct nbs_pvt *p;
  151. p = ast->tech_pvt;
  152. if (option_debug)
  153. ast_log(LOG_DEBUG, "nbs_hangup(%s)\n", ast->name);
  154. if (!ast->tech_pvt) {
  155. ast_log(LOG_WARNING, "Asked to hangup channel not connected\n");
  156. return 0;
  157. }
  158. nbs_destroy(p);
  159. ast->tech_pvt = NULL;
  160. ast_setstate(ast, AST_STATE_DOWN);
  161. return 0;
  162. }
  163. static struct ast_frame *nbs_xread(struct ast_channel *ast)
  164. {
  165. struct nbs_pvt *p = ast->tech_pvt;
  166. /* Some nice norms */
  167. p->fr.datalen = 0;
  168. p->fr.samples = 0;
  169. p->fr.data = NULL;
  170. p->fr.src = type;
  171. p->fr.offset = 0;
  172. p->fr.mallocd=0;
  173. p->fr.delivery.tv_sec = 0;
  174. p->fr.delivery.tv_usec = 0;
  175. ast_log(LOG_DEBUG, "Returning null frame on %s\n", ast->name);
  176. return &p->fr;
  177. }
  178. static int nbs_xwrite(struct ast_channel *ast, struct ast_frame *frame)
  179. {
  180. struct nbs_pvt *p = ast->tech_pvt;
  181. /* Write a frame of (presumably voice) data */
  182. if (frame->frametype != AST_FRAME_VOICE) {
  183. if (frame->frametype != AST_FRAME_IMAGE)
  184. ast_log(LOG_WARNING, "Don't know what to do with frame type '%d'\n", frame->frametype);
  185. return 0;
  186. }
  187. if (!(frame->subclass &
  188. (AST_FORMAT_SLINEAR))) {
  189. ast_log(LOG_WARNING, "Cannot handle frames in %d format\n", frame->subclass);
  190. return 0;
  191. }
  192. if (ast->_state != AST_STATE_UP) {
  193. /* Don't try tos end audio on-hook */
  194. return 0;
  195. }
  196. if (nbs_write(p->nbs, frame->data, frame->datalen / 2) < 0)
  197. return -1;
  198. return 0;
  199. }
  200. static struct ast_channel *nbs_new(struct nbs_pvt *i, int state)
  201. {
  202. struct ast_channel *tmp;
  203. tmp = ast_channel_alloc(1);
  204. if (tmp) {
  205. tmp->tech = &nbs_tech;
  206. snprintf(tmp->name, sizeof(tmp->name), "NBS/%s", i->stream);
  207. tmp->type = type;
  208. tmp->fds[0] = nbs_fd(i->nbs);
  209. tmp->nativeformats = prefformat;
  210. tmp->rawreadformat = prefformat;
  211. tmp->rawwriteformat = prefformat;
  212. tmp->writeformat = prefformat;
  213. tmp->readformat = prefformat;
  214. ast_setstate(tmp, state);
  215. if (state == AST_STATE_RING)
  216. tmp->rings = 1;
  217. tmp->tech_pvt = i;
  218. strncpy(tmp->context, context, sizeof(tmp->context)-1);
  219. strncpy(tmp->exten, "s", sizeof(tmp->exten) - 1);
  220. tmp->language[0] = '\0';
  221. i->owner = tmp;
  222. ast_mutex_lock(&usecnt_lock);
  223. usecnt++;
  224. ast_mutex_unlock(&usecnt_lock);
  225. ast_update_use_count();
  226. if (state != AST_STATE_DOWN) {
  227. if (ast_pbx_start(tmp)) {
  228. ast_log(LOG_WARNING, "Unable to start PBX on %s\n", tmp->name);
  229. ast_hangup(tmp);
  230. }
  231. }
  232. } else
  233. ast_log(LOG_WARNING, "Unable to allocate channel structure\n");
  234. return tmp;
  235. }
  236. static struct ast_channel *nbs_request(const char *type, int format, void *data, int *cause)
  237. {
  238. int oldformat;
  239. struct nbs_pvt *p;
  240. struct ast_channel *tmp = NULL;
  241. oldformat = format;
  242. format &= (AST_FORMAT_SLINEAR);
  243. if (!format) {
  244. ast_log(LOG_NOTICE, "Asked to get a channel of unsupported format '%d'\n", oldformat);
  245. return NULL;
  246. }
  247. p = nbs_alloc(data);
  248. if (p) {
  249. tmp = nbs_new(p, AST_STATE_DOWN);
  250. if (!tmp)
  251. nbs_destroy(p);
  252. }
  253. return tmp;
  254. }
  255. static int __unload_module(void)
  256. {
  257. /* First, take us out of the channel loop */
  258. ast_channel_unregister(&nbs_tech);
  259. return 0;
  260. }
  261. int unload_module(void)
  262. {
  263. return __unload_module();
  264. }
  265. int load_module()
  266. {
  267. /* Make sure we can register our channel type */
  268. if (ast_channel_register(&nbs_tech)) {
  269. ast_log(LOG_ERROR, "Unable to register channel class %s\n", type);
  270. __unload_module();
  271. return -1;
  272. }
  273. return 0;
  274. }
  275. int usecount()
  276. {
  277. return usecnt;
  278. }
  279. char *description()
  280. {
  281. return (char *) desc;
  282. }
  283. char *key()
  284. {
  285. return ASTERISK_GPL_KEY;
  286. }
